Fourteen

Day Two: Sunday

Eva woke up with a head full of feelings and images. The heated kiss with Dan in the office. The deceptive allure of Wharton’s flirtatious eyes. Joanne’s keen eyes observing her awkwardness around their newest client. And finally, the revelation of Dan and Alice Perry. Waking up went from warm, fuzzy, sweetness to guilty pleasures to wide-eyed outrage in ten seconds flat. Eva stared up at the ceiling, then sat up to begin the mission of unloading her upset on Dan. But she remembered. Dan had slept on the sofa after she had ignored him, drunk wine, and read up on the signed first editions by George Bernard Shaw. It was tedious work – especially the ignoring Dan part. But it had to be done. Only the white wine made it any more bearable. She had left Dan with one final reassuring kiss – a peck on his head, before walking away alone to bed. But no matter how much Dan had begged for clemency, she still owed him a little more punishment. In the background, the warm fuzzy feelings of before lingered in wait. It would have been nice to have a bed companion for a while, but Dan needed to learn his lesson. Eva blinked, opened the bedside drawer to hunt for the paracetamol, found the packet empty, then rolled up out of bed with a groan.
